Broken seals

Condensation and misting are caused by a breach in the seal between the panes of your double glazing. This allows moisture to get into the insulation portion of the window, causing the efficiency of the window to reduce and warm air to escape into the home. Luckily, there are simple steps you can take to fix these issues.

The most important thing to do is to determine if the condensation or misting is on the outside or inside the window. If the condensation is outside, it's a natural phenomenon that is caused by changing weather conditions and doesn't indicate a problem with your double glazing. If the condensation is on the inside, it's a sign that the seal has broken and needs to be replaced.

One of the best ways to stop a double-glazing seal from breaking is by keeping the frame in good shape. Every two years the exterior seams should be caulked, and the wood must be given an all-new coat. Avoid high-pressure washing on your windows, as this could damage the insulated unit.

Another option to prevent damage is to apply an reflective window film to the window. This will help reduce heat loss, which will allow the glass to perform more effectively. However, it is essential to check with the manufacturer prior to adding reflective window film because some manufacturers claim this will invalidate their warranty. Energy efficiency

Double glazing can be a great investment for any home. It provides more warmth, block out outside noise and is an excellent way to save energy. This is because the layer of gas between the two panes of glass acts as an insulation, keeping the cold air outside and your warm air inside, thus cutting down on your heating costs.

However, if your double-glazed is prone to condensation between the windows and the glass, it won't serving its purpose and you may see a slight increase in your energy bills. Luckily, misted windows can be fixed and, in some cases it's all that's needed.

The most frequent cause of a misted window is that the seal between the two glass panes has been breached, allowing moisture to enter. This is often caused by old windows that have deteriorated over time. However, it could also be caused by a window that has been damaged by accident or a window that was poorly installed.
